Olivia is a Form 4 student at Mchinji Mission Community Day Secondary School who dreams of becoming a Chief Systems Analyst.

In her quest for success, Olivia joined CHATS (Creating Healthy Approaches to Success) after being inspired by AGE Africa’s pitch day at her school. CHATS focuses on developing girls’ agency and is having a profound impact on Olivia’s life. She has gained confidence, leadership skills, and a strong work ethic, resulting in improved academic performance. During the All Scholars Retreat in Mchinji, she caught the attention of a Member of Parliament for Mchinji District Olivia’s accomplishments prompted the MP to praise AGE Africa and encourage us to continue empowering girls.

The impact of CHATS extends beyond Olivia. The headteacher of Mchinji Mission CDSS praises the program for positively influencing students’ performance, discipline, and enthusiasm for learning. In fact, he credits CHATS with significantly reducing the school dropout rate due to pregnancy.
